The Agreement to Share Office Space Between Attorneys or Other Professions is designed for practitioners, such as attorneys in Fort Collins, Bronx, to effectively share office space while maintaining independence in their legal practices. The key features of this agreement include provisions for the sharing of office space, duration of the agreement, clarification of the relationship between parties, and detailed expense sharing guidelines. The form outlines the responsibilities for shared expenses, such as rent, utilities, and maintenance, while making clear which expenses are individually owed by each party. Notably, it emphasizes that sharing this space does not create a partnership, ensuring each party's clients and income remain distinct. Additionally, the agreement contains restrictions on the use of the premises and establishes a process for any modifications.
